Transaction 15807e1d2fd59351725956fad05e19dba8c87c3d1fe7e3234b3e220873e6edcb
1 Input
1 Output
-
15807e1d2fd59351725956fad05e19dba8c87c3d1fe7e3234b3e220873e6edcb:0
- value
- 19386
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cfb37ceb7727203cbae1a5a499e47fca0b0b9d14 OP_EQUAL
- address
- 3LdEpJ5czSzMdxhGodtoiw2eD3MUYifdQ8